aboutsummaryrefslogtreecommitdiff
path: root/sim
diff options
context:
space:
mode:
authorMike Frysinger <vapier@gentoo.org>2011-11-07 16:26:05 +0000
committerMike Frysinger <vapier@gentoo.org>2011-11-07 16:26:05 +0000
commit481d79819e0e47f23f20408a6595333012da6f58 (patch)
treec47193a904ca58d414cd6828b6163d9c41ad9789 /sim
parentc90460e4507bd27eb11a55e3f4591309cfe6821e (diff)
downloadgdb-481d79819e0e47f23f20408a6595333012da6f58.zip
gdb-481d79819e0e47f23f20408a6595333012da6f58.tar.gz
gdb-481d79819e0e47f23f20408a6595333012da6f58.tar.bz2
sim: mn10300: fix typo in if check
The code looks like it should be doing a bit check, not logical. URL: http://sourceware.org/bugzilla/show_bug.cgi?id=9302 Signed-off-by: Mike Frysinger <vapier@gentoo.org>
Diffstat (limited to 'sim')
-rw-r--r--sim/mn10300/ChangeLog5
-rw-r--r--sim/mn10300/dv-mn103iop.c4
2 files changed, 7 insertions, 2 deletions
diff --git a/sim/mn10300/ChangeLog b/sim/mn10300/ChangeLog
index cc2cbb1..5374542 100644
--- a/sim/mn10300/ChangeLog
+++ b/sim/mn10300/ChangeLog
@@ -1,3 +1,8 @@
+2011-11-07 Mike Frysinger <vapier@gentoo.org>
+
+ PR sim/9302
+ * dv-mn103iop.c (write_dedicated_control_reg): Convert && to &.
+
2011-10-19 Mike Frysinger <vapier@gentoo.org>
* configure: Regenerate after common/acinclude.m4 update.
diff --git a/sim/mn10300/dv-mn103iop.c b/sim/mn10300/dv-mn103iop.c
index 15a299d..8134377 100644
--- a/sim/mn10300/dv-mn103iop.c
+++ b/sim/mn10300/dv-mn103iop.c
@@ -463,7 +463,7 @@ write_dedicated_control_reg (struct hw *me,
/* select on io_port_reg: */
if ( io_port_reg == P2SS )
{
- if ( (buf && 0xfc) != 0 )
+ if ( (buf & 0xfc) != 0 )
{
hw_abort(me, "Cannot write to read-only bits in p2ss.");
}
@@ -474,7 +474,7 @@ write_dedicated_control_reg (struct hw *me,
}
else
{
- if ( (buf && 0xf0) != 0 )
+ if ( (buf & 0xf0) != 0 )
{
hw_abort(me, "Cannot write to read-only bits in p4ss.");
}